Cardinal Pietro Parolin, Secretary of State of the Holy See, will preside over the solemn Pontifical in the Cathedral of Palermo on the occasion of the liturgical feast of Santa Rosalia on 15 July. The announcement was made by the Archbishop of Palermo Monsignor Corrado Lorefice at the end of the diocesan synodal assembly which was held yesterday evening in the parish of Santa Luisa de Marillac.

A significant and prestigious presence, that of Parolin, not only for Palermo which is preparing to celebrate the fourth centenary of the discovery of the mortal remains of “Santuzza” but for the entire archdiocese. Cardinal Pietro Parolin, 69 years old, was appointed Secretary of State by Pope Francis in 2013 and in 2023 he is a member of the Council of Cardinals. “His presence in Palermo on the occasion of the celebrations for the 400 years since the discovery of the remains of Santa Rosalia – underlined the Archbishop – represents a sign of the Pope’s closeness to Palermo and to the people of Palermo and is also a sign of full ecclesial communion ”.
